US Senator Marsha Blackburn spoke at the Bitcoin Policy Summit in 2024 about how Bitcoin can help consumers save on increasing credit card transaction fees and hidden charges. At the event, she highlighted the growing concern over swipe fees for merchants, leading many to explore alternatives like Bitcoin as a means to avoid these expensive processing costs.
Despite this, she points out that cryptocurrencies could potentially enhance the process of purchasing rentals, mortgages, or cars if they become more commonly used. Blackburn expresses excitement about Bitcoin’s user-friendly traits and the financial freedom and privacy it offers individuals.
